INSIGHT

Chipmaker's Optimism Masks Risk

  • Jensen Huang dismisses near-term AGI as "biblically far away" while NVIDIA profits from AI acceleration.
  • The hosts argue his industry focus blinds him to rapid intelligence dynamics and tipping points.
INSIGHT

Insider–Executive Perception Gap

  • Insiders and customers exhibit a wide split in AGI beliefs compared with executives like Jensen.
  • This perception gap amplifies governance and public awareness failures around AI development.
ANECDOTE

Claude Code As Senior Engineer

  • John Sherman describes using Claude Code to fix deployment errors like a senior engineer taking over the keyboard.
  • He says Cloud Code feels like a human-level helper that resolves sticky infrastructure problems.
